Keralites celebrate Christmas

Thiruvananthapuram: Rejoicing the birth of Jesus Christ, Keralites Sunday celebrated Christmas with traditional fervour and piety with faithful thronging churches for special prayers and mass.

As church bells tolled signalling the moment of Nativity, faithful converged for the Midnight mass in cathedrals and churches as senior bishops and priests delivered the Christmas message.

While Cardinal Mar Baselios Cleemis led the midnight mass at the St Mary's Cathedral of Syro Malankara Catholic Church in the state capital, Cardinal Mar George Alanchery of Syro Malabar Catholic Church conducted the service in Kochi and gave out the Christmas message.

Christians account for nearly one-fourth of the population in the state.

The festival was also celebrated with much fanfare in churches in norther Malabar region of the state.

Churches and homes were tastefully decked up with cribs depicting the birth-in-the manger scene and stars twinkling on Christmas trees.

Kerala Governor P Sathasivam and Chief minister Pinarayi Vijayan greeted the people on the occasion of Christmas.

A 100 feet tall Santa has been put up at nearby Neyyatinkara as part of Christmas celebrations.

Bakeries and cake stalls across the state witnessed heavy rush.
